How to Walk on Drywall Stilts
If you’ve never walked on drywall stilts before, it’s a good idea to start on the lowest setting and work your way up slowly. You may also want to have someone there to help you balance.
Also, you should wear shoes or boots with good traction to help you grip onto the stilt’s footrests, and you want to make sure that the straps are tight enough to secure the stilts. DRYWALL STILTS BUYER’S GUIDE
Build
You want a stable and strong drywall stilt. You want to look at the frame materials and choose things like high-quality aluminum or steel.
This will ensure that your stilts last through years of use and that you won’t have issues with them cracking or breaking. Also, how your stilts connect is an important feature, and you want them to lock into place.
Comfort Level
As you’ll be spending a decent amount of time on these stilts, so you want to be comfortable while you’re upon them. You want to find a pair of stilts that have a wider foot pedal and a heel cup. Your calf supports should also be padded, so your skin doesn’t get irritated when it rubs against them.
Height Levels
The main reason you buy drywall stilts is to get the extra height that allows you to quickly and easily reach your desired areas.
Many drywall stilts come with several different adjustable heights that typically start at 15-inches and go up to over 50-inches. You want to make sure that you’re getting the height you need.
Durability
The other major factor you should consider when shopping for drywall stilts is their durability. Stilts can cost a lot of money, and they’re not something that you want to have to replace frequently. The worst models on the market are prone to breakage, while the best can last years with no issues.
Most models today are made from aluminum, though the best models have been made with magnesium as well, which makes them lighter without sacrificing any of their strength. Investing in a model made from those materials increases the odds of getting a pair that will last a long time.
No-Slip Grip
Remember to look at your stilt’s feet. They should be wide enough to provide the stability and balance you need. Ideally, you want them to have a rubber backing, and it should be textured.
This will let it grip onto a variety of surfaces, and make it safer for you while you maneuver your stilts around your work area.
Weight Capacity
Did you know that different drywall stilts come with different weight limits? These weight limits are designed to let you know exactly how much weight your stilts can safely hold.
This weight capacity can range anywhere from 225 pounds up to over 350 pounds, so it’s always very important to pick out stilts that fit your weight category. They’re less prone to breaking and safer for you to use.
